THE CENTRAL BANK OF KENYA APPROVAL RECEIVED FOR NEDBANK GROUP’S OFFER TO ACQUIRE C.
66% OF NCBA GROUP PLC (NCBA)

1. Introduction

    1.1. Shareholders and noteholders of Nedbank Group are referred to the announcements released on SENS
         regarding Nedbank Group’s offer to acquire c. 66% of the issued ordinary shares of NCBA from NCBA
         Shareholders on a pro rata basis (the Offer or the Transaction), the last of which was dated 21 July 2026 and
         related to the initial results of the Offer which indicated that Nedbank Group had achieved its targeted 66%
         shareholding in NCBA (Announcements).

    1.2. Capitalised terms used herein that are not otherwise defined bear the meanings ascribed to them in the
         Announcements.

2. Central Bank of Kenya Approval

    2.1. Nedbank Group is pleased to advise shareholders and noteholders that the Central Bank of Kenya (the CBK)
         has granted NCBA Group approval for the Transaction.

    2.2. The receipt of approval from the CBK represents an important milestone in the progression of the Transaction.

3. Regulatory Approvals

    3.1. The majority of the regulatory approvals required for the Offer have now been obtained. The outstanding
         regulatory approvals are progressing in accordance with their expected timelines and are anticipated to be
         received towards the end of the third quarter of 2026.

    3.2. The Offer remains subject to the fulfilment (or waiver, at the discretion of Nedbank Group or NCBA to the extent
         permissible by law) of certain Conditions specified in the Offer Document.

4. Settlement and timetable of remaining key events

    4.1. As previously disclosed, settlement of the consideration to which each accepting NCBA Shareholder is entitled
         will be effected from the 10th trading day and within 14 trading days from the date of announcement by
         Nedbank Group that all Conditions to which the Offer is subject have been fulfilled or waived in all respects, in
         accordance with the terms of the Offer Document.
